        한국 서남해안 우이도의 해조상과 (海藻相) 군집구조

        최도성,김광용,이욱재,김지희 ( Do Sung Choi,Kwang Young Kim,Wook Jae Lee,Jee Hee Kim ) 한국환경생물학회 1994 환경생물 : 환경생물학회지 Vol.12 No.2

        Marine algal flora and structure of benthic algal community at intertidal zone of Uido Island on the West-southern coast of Korea have been investigated from August, 1992 to August, 1993. A total of 142 species, 3 blue-green, 21 green, 26 brown, 92 red algae, were identified through this study. Algal vegetation of this islands belong to inland sea area is characterized by temperate flora. The number of species, biomass, and coverage were the highest at the low tidal zone and the lowest in high tidal zone or steep gradient region. Among three transects, they were higher at transect C than transect A and B. This is presumably due to the fact that they significantly influenced by tidal level, intertidal gradient, and kind and stability of substarata. The dominant species in coverage were Gloiopeltis furcata, Gelidium divaricatium, Myelophycus simplex at high and middle tidal zones and Sargassum thunbergii, Corallina pilulifera, Ulva pertusa, Myelophycus simplex, Hizikia fusiformis at low tidal zone, which are common species at intertidal flora of west-southern coast of Korea.

        한국산 홍조 몽우리두층게발에 관한 분류학적 연구

        최도성,Choi , Do-Sung 한국조류학회(藻類) 2007 ALGAE Vol.22 No.3

        Morphological and anatomical characters of Amphiroa rigida Lamouroux were investigated with field materials and taxonomic accounts are given to the species. The species grows in the subtidal zone of Cheju island, and is characterized by semiendophytic habit in Hydrolithon onkodes. The species is well defined by about 1 cm height, loosely tufted thallus with irregular branches, two-tiered geniculum with equal length, geniculum tier connecting by oblique end walls, and conceptacles buried in cortices of intergeniculum. Korean isolates have etrasporangial, male and female conceptacles. The structure and developmental patterns of conceptacles are very similar to those shown in previous studies.

        도시하천 생태 체험 프로그램 적용이 초등학생의 환경 감수성에 미치는 영향

        배효선(Hyo-Seon Bae),최도성(Do Sung Choi),김영록(Young Rock Kim) 한국환경교육학회 2011 環境 敎育 Vol.24 No.1

        The goal of this study is to investigate the effect of ecological experience program at the urban stream on the environmental sensitivity of elementary school students. In order to perform this study, two classes of 6th graders of M elementary school in Gwangju were selected and divided into two groups; one groups was the experimental group that undergoes ecological experience program at the Gwangju River, and another group was the control group that studied about environment in the classroom. The results of this study were as following. First of all, the experimental group has more influence on the environmental sensitivity than the control group. Secondly, the ecological experience program at the urban stream can be the effective method to build the environmental sensitivity of elementary school students. In conclusion, the results are showing that the ecological experience program at the urban stream helps elementary school students to change their environmental sensitivity in positive ways, also it gives idea that how to protect the environment and what they actually can do.

        돼지풀속(Ambrosia) 식물 2종에 대한 분류학적 검토

        최도성 ( Do Sung Choi ) 한국환경생물학회 2005 환경생물 : 환경생물학회지 Vol.23 No.2

        N/A This study carried out to certify of taxonomic delimitation in A. artemisiaefolia, A. trifida, A. trifida for. integrifolia, and A. psilostachya in the area of literature and experiment. A. psilostachya was not a vestige of naturalized in Korea and A. trifida and A. trifida for. integrifolia didn`t have any valuable differences of morphological and molecular biological experiment. I arranged that naturalized species in Ambrosia are A. artemisiaefolia L. and A. trifida L. in Korea.

        한국산 홍조 (紅藻) 참보라색우무 ( Symphyocladia latiuscula ( Harvey ) Yamada ) 의 형태와 생식

        최도성(Do Sung Choi),이인규(In Kyu Lee) 한국식물학회 1991 Journal of Plant Biology Vol.34 No.1

        The morphotaxonomic characters and life history of Symphyocladia latiuscula (Harvey) Yamada were investigated with field and laboratory culture materials. The species is well defined by a 5-15 ㎝ hight, entirely corticated thallus and congenital fusion of 5-7 segments between main axis and laterals. Although all the reproductive structures are basically similar to those of other species of the genus, it is characteristic that the pinnulae are transformed into the flabellated tetrasporangial stichidia. Vegetative trichoblasts are known to be absent in the Pterosiphonieae, but their presence in S. latiuscula does not accept its taxonomic position in that tribe. As a result, the occurrence of vegetative trichoblast is not useful for a taxonomic character to distinguish the tribes. The species shows a Polysiphonia-type life history involving a dimorphic alternation of gametophytes and sporophytes in culture and field. It grows below the middle intertidal zone in all the coasts of Korea throughout the year, although fertile plants are normally found during the summer months.

        한국산 홍조 (紅藻) 산호말과 (科) 애기산호말속 (屬) ( Jania ) 식물에 대한 분류학적 검토

        최도성 (Do Sung Choi) 한국식물학회 1993 Journal of Plant Biology Vol.36 No.2

        Taxonomic accounts are given to four species of Jania, Rhodophyta from Korea; J. adhaerens Lamouroux, J. nipponica (Yendo) Yendo, J. radiata (Yendo) Yendo and J. yenoshimensis (Yendo) Yendo. J. adhaerens is an epiphyte and characterized by massive tufts with decussate-dichotomous branches. J. nipponica growing on the rocks is different from other plants by erect tuft with lowangle dichotomouse branches. J. radiata has a small epiphytic thallus (5 mm) and flat, flabellate-dichotomous branches. And J. yenoshimensis grows on the rocks in sublittoral regions and has compressed, fastigate, regular-dichotomous branches. This species is distinguished from others by the formation of slender moniliform branchlets. Among these, J. yenoshimensis is first reported in Korea in this study.

        제주산 홍조 게발속 (屬) ( Amphiroa ) 식물에 대한 주해

        최도성(Do Sung Choi),이인규(In Kyu Lee) 한국식물학회 1989 Journal of Plant Biology Vol.32 No.4

        Morphotaxonomic accounts are given to four species of Amphiroa, Rhodophyta from Cheju Island; A. valonioides Yendo, A. itonoi Srimanobhas et Masaki, A. rigida Lamourous, and A. misakiensis Yendo. A. valonioides has one-tiered genicula of unequal length and is semiendophytic in other Amphiroan species, whereas A. rigida has two-tiered genicula of equal length and is semi-endophytic in non-articulated coralline alga. A. misakiensis has five to thirteen-tiered genicula of unequal length and forms tufts on rocks where the branches are often recumbent. A. rigida is introduced for the first time to Korean flora.

        현행 전국과학전람회에 실태 및 개선방안에 관한 연구

        최도성(Do Sung Choi),한효의(Hyo Eui Han) 한국초등과학교육학회 2001 초등과학교육 Vol.20 No.1

        The National Science Fairs has been held in every year for the promotion of science and technology and scientific civil life. The purpose of this study is to survey the current problems in National Science Fairs by making up a question and to improve them. The study makes up a questionnaires about the existing Science Fairs to the teachers who have submitted their works to the Science Fairs and suggest the ways of improvement. The result of questionnaires is that little availability of reference materials, difficulty of paying proper attention to regular classes because of frequent travels, and absence of experimental devices and experimental rooms are perceived as major obstacles in preparing for the exhibition. Respondents teacher also pointed out some problems with the current organization of the exhibition; nonvoluntary selection process for the potential authors, separation of research content from regular teaching materials, unrealistically high standard, low participation rate of teachers, so many exhibited works, lack of professionalism in the screening process. The majority however, agreed that the exhibition event should be continuously done, after remedial measures have been taken about the problems. First, the side of science education is emphasized in a purpose of the science fairs to let activity related to science fair be closely connected with school education. Second, students have to be divided according to grade. Third, research level have to be set not too higher than regular instruction content. Fourth, hand book related to science fairs have to be manufactured and spread. Fifth, data of local science fair have to be arranged. Sixth, judging section have to be subdivided and people related to science education have to be included to a judge. Seventh, excellent works have to be support to participate in ISEF.

        한국과 미국 초등학교 과학과 교육과정 및 교과서 비교 연구

        최도성 ( Do Sung Choi ) 서울敎育大學校 初等敎育硏究所 2013 한국초등교육 Vol.24 No.2

        본 연구는 과학과 교육과정 및 과학 교과서의 질적 수준을 향상시킬 수 있는 요인을 찾아보기 위해 미국과 한국 과학과 교육과정의 특징, 과학 교과서의 구성 체제, Romey의 분석법에 따른 교과서의 탐구적 척도를 비교하는 것이며, 이를 위해 2007 개정교육과정 초등학교 과학과 교육과정과 과학 교과서(실험관찰 포함), 미국 플로리다 주의 NGSSS: Science(New generation Sunshine State Standard: Science)와 Houghton Mifflin Harcourt 출판사의 Science Fusion 교과서(Flipchart 포함)를 대상으로 한다. 첫째, 한국은 국가 수준 교육과정에 따라 학교 교육과정을 편성?운영하는 반면 미국은 원칙적으로 국가수준의 교육과정은 존재하지 않지만 낙오학생방지법과 이에 따른 국가기준이 있고, 주 정부에서 제시하는 성취기준을 토대로 자율적으로 학교 교육과정을 편성?운영하고 있다. 둘째, 미국 플로리다 주의 교육과정은 K-8과정의 과학을 과학의 본성, 물상과학, 지구 및 우주과학, 생명과학 4개 영역으로 구분하고 있으며, 별도로 단원을 마련하여 과학자적인 태도육성을 강조하고 있다. 한국의 경우 물리학과 화학 영역을 독립 단원으로 분리시키고 있으나 미국의 경우 물리학 안에 화학 영역을 포함하고 있고, 생명 영역의 비중을 저학년에서 높게 둔 것이 특징이다. 셋째, Romey의 방법에 따른 교과서의 탐구적 척도를 조사한 결과 한국과 미국 교과서 모두 탐구적인 교과서로 판정되었다. 그러나 한국 교과서의 경우 탐구적 척도가 지나쳐 학습 자료가 부족한 교과서와의 경계구간에 걸쳐있고 아동 스스로 학습하는데 보다 많은 노력을 요구하는 문제점을 갖고 있으며, 미국 교과서는 과학적 방법의 강조, 과학적 도구 사용 방법 제시, 각 Lesson마다 다른 교과와의 Link 제시, STEM 및 과학자에 대한 이야기 등 다양하고 폭넓은 내용을 포괄하고 있다는 것이 장점으로 파악되었다.
